‎In a recent statement via his official X account, human rights lawyer and political activist, Dele Farotimi, has called on Nigerians to come together to remove the All Progressives Congress (APC) from power, accusing the ruling party of destroying the country.

 

‎Farotimi warned that unless Nigerians unite to reinvent their nation, the APC will continue to cause harm through bad governance, corruption, and insecurity.

‎”If Nigerians do not find common purpose to get rid of the APC and reinvent their country to work for their benefit, the APC will be left free to do what it does best; kill, steal, and destroy. Imagine the obscene figures coming out of Professor Umahi’s mouth,” he wrote.

 

‎In his post, Farotimi said the APC has brought hardship and division to the country since coming to power.

‎He accused the party of failing to deliver on its promises and of enriching a few at the expense of the masses.

‎According to him, the ruling class has continued to “kill, steal, and destroy” while citizens remain silent.

‎Farotimi urged Nigerians to develop a common purpose that prioritizes national interest over political or ethnic loyalty.

‎He said citizens must take responsibility for rebuilding the country instead of waiting for politicians to act.

‎He also referenced comments reportedly made by the Minister of Works, Professor David Umahi, suggesting that government spending figures have become excessive and detached from the realities faced by ordinary Nigerians.

‎Farotimi described these figures as “obscene,” saying they show how disconnected those in power are from the suffering of the people.
